How much do inside sales rep j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average yearly pay for inside sales rep in Georgia is $43,461.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$33,400.00 and $49,800.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an inside sales rep?

Inside Sales Reps are sales professionals who primarily work from an office or remote location to sell products or services to customers, rather than meeting them face-to-face. They use phone calls, emails, and online meetings to reach potential clients, manage accounts, and close deals. Inside Sales Reps are responsible for identifying leads, following up with prospects, and maintaining customer relationships to achieve sales targets. This role often requires strong communication skills, persistence, and the ability to learn about the products or services being sold.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an inside sales rep,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Inside Sales Rep, you need strong communication, persuasion, and negotiation skills, typically supported by a background in sales or customer service. Familiarity with customer relationship management (CRM) software, phone systems, and basic sales analytics tools is often required. Resilience, active listening, and the ability to build rapport quickly are standout soft skills in this role. These skills and qualities are crucial for consistently meeting sales targets and fostering positive client relationships in a competitive sales environment.

What are some common challenges an inside sales rep faces when working with leads and how can they be overcome?

Inside Sales Reps often encounter challenges such as reaching decision-makers, handling objections, and maintaining consistent follow-up with leads. Overcoming these obstacles typically involves leveraging CRM tools to track interactions, personalizing communication to address specific client needs, and developing strong listening and problem-solving skills. Collaborating closely with marketing and account management teams also helps ensure a seamless handoff and enhances the chances of converting leads to customers.

What is the difference between Inside Sales Rep vs Outside Sales Rep?

AspectInside Sales RepOutside Sales Rep
Work EnvironmentOffice or remote, primarily via phone, email, and onlineIn the field, meeting clients face-to-face
Sales ApproachInbound and outbound calls, virtual presentationsIn-person meetings, on-site demos
Required SkillsCommunication, CRM proficiency, product knowledgeRelationship building, travel readiness, presentation skills
Common IndustriesTechnology, wholesale, B2B servicesReal estate, manufacturing, industrial sales

Inside Sales Reps typically work in an office or remotely, focusing on virtual communication methods like calls and emails. Outside Sales Reps often travel to meet clients face-to-face. Both roles require strong communication skills, but outside sales may demand more relationship-building and travel. The choice depends on the industry and sales approach preferred by the employer.
